Meaning 1

Either of a pair of symbols,〔 〕, sometimes used in Japanese to enclose comments in quoted text.

History

Etymology

Calque from Japanese 亀(きっ)甲(こう)括(かっ)弧(こ) (kikkōkakko, literally “tortoise shell bracket”), due to their resemblance to the shell of a tortoise. By surface analysis, tortoise shell + bracket.
